Highway terrain dually tires are built for road-focused truck owners who care about towing stability, daily comfort, lower tread noise, and long-distance drivability. This page helps shoppers compare highway tire direction with dually wheels and complete package options.
Highway tire fitment depends on tire size, wheel diameter, load rating, rear spacing, and clearance, especially when paired with aftermarket dually wheels.
Highway terrain tires often pair well with practical 17 inch, 18 inch, 20 inch, and 22 inch dually wheel setups depending on the truck.
Choose highway terrain tires when road manners, towing, long drives, and lower noise matter more than aggressive off-road tread.
Highway tire pages support buyers who use their dually as a tow rig, work truck, or long-distance hauler. The content should focus on road use and fitment confidence.
Highway terrain packages can create a clean daily and towing setup when the tire rating, wheel size, and stance are matched correctly.
Always verify your exact year, model, axle, bolt pattern, wheel width, offset, tire size, tire clearance, and load needs before ordering. If you are unsure, start with the Year Make Model search so the store can narrow the results before you compare final style and price.
